When can you join the armed forces?

You can join the armed forces after

  1. You can join Armed Forces after class twelfth

The interested candidates after completing their class 10+2 exams can choose the preferred branch of the Indian Armed Forces. Candidates can enrol in National Defence Academy after clearing their 10+2 examination. The examination for entry in NDA is conducted twice every year. This esteemed academy is situated in Pune. . The examination for the Airforce is held twice every year. The examination is held by the Central Airmen Selection Board. The female candidates looking forward to serving the nation by joining the defence services can choose Military Nursing Services, the exam for which is conducted by DG-AFMS of the Indian Army. 

Aspirants who wish to join the Indian Navy can choose Navy Artificer Apprentice and SSR exam,

Students who clear their 10+2 examination with either Physics or Mathematics can choose the Navik General Duty examination which is conducted by the Defence Ministry, Government of India.

  1. Candidates can join after graduation

There are immense opportunities for graduate candidates who are looking forward to working for the nation by enrolling in the Armed Forces. Once completed graduation from any documented university, aspirants can sit for the Combined Defence Services Examination which is held twice every year. This CDS exam is the most chosen option by the candidates looking to join defence services. Even the candidates can apply for the Indian Navy after completing their BE/B tech.

They can do this through the INET exam. It is the Indian Navy Entrance Test. This is done to give Permanent Commission and Short Commission to the newly appointed officers. The candidates looking to join Indian Air Force can appear for AFCAT to join ground duty as well as the flying branch of flying services.

How to prepare for Defence exams?

The first step is that you recognize the need for why you want to join the defence forces. Once the need is recognized you will be motivated to work hard to reach your goal. You should work on developing qualities like that of an officer. Also, try to maintain your mental as well as physical strength. The next step is to increase your know-how about defence services and gather all the necessary information about defence deals.

You should also learn about ranks, training institutes, weapons and missiles present with the Indian army. You should keep yourself updated about the current affairs and the schemes started by Government.

Always remain positive and work on your communication skills for the interview and next procedure. Always stay active when you do the questions as this will increase your confidence. Lastly, do some workouts and exercises to keep you fit both physically as well as mentally.
